Describes the attachment of the energized myosin head to the exposed active sites on the actin filament, forming a cross-bridge.

What is Cross-Bridge Formation?

A temporary linkage formed between the myosin head and the actin filament during muscle contraction.

Common mistakes

  • Confusing the role of troponin and tropomyosin.

  • Forgetting the requirement of calcium ions for binding site exposure.

  • Not understanding that cross-bridge formation is the *first* step of interaction, not the power stroke itself.
